Management should determine at which point the software development enters and exits each stage. Going for a quick win here, you smash yourself right into a wall. Inhouse development is what you essentially receive. In most cases, such cooperation allows you to save money when compared to similar services in your country. The pros and cons of developing your own software versus outsourcing every business has unique software requirements to function effectively. Outsourcing app development and inhouse app development have their advocates, ready to tell you all pros and cons. How much should you pay for software outsourcing to get. Outsourcing brings many advantages that saas development. In this article, we present a list of top saas companies that outsourced development and become successful. How much outsourcing software app development costs. This makes it the most expensive country for it services in europe if we judge by the average prices for software development services. Lets explore their key differences, pros, and cons, and find the most beneficial method for successful business growth. Here are a few more things that make up the average cost of software development. Check out our detailed report on offshore software development rates by country done by diceus offshore development team ukraine.
An outsourced team provides many benefits to your start up. How much should you pay for software outsourcing to get the. How to lower cost of outsourcing it services and retain quality. What are the costs of outsourcing software development. Depending on the stage, the associated development costs will be expensed or capitalized. Outsourcing helps thousands of software development companies create highquality software at a lower cost. Capitalization of internaluse software costs is an area where companies often misapply gaap codification topic 35040.
Outsourcing is the business practice of contracting with an outside party to take care of certain tasks instead of hiring new employees or assigning those tasks to existing staff. How much does custom software development outsourcing cost. Materials and services consumed in the development effort, such as third party development fees, software purchase costs, and travel costs related to development work. But that quality comes at a very steep price very high software development costs. Go through all listed arguments and decide which side works better for you. The high costs of domestic developers and the employee scarcity drive american buyers to seek for foreign specialists.
Moreover, there are some estimation examples of different apps. Average hourly rates for offshore software development 2019. In competitive industries, such as healthcare and it, these savings are often passed on the consumers as companies aim to offer a more competitive solution in their specific field or niche. The security costs of outsourcing software development before outsourcing software development, enterprises should make sure they perform due diligence and understand the associated security costs. Nov 18, 2019 outsourcing software development is a business trend that we strongly believe will keep on expanding in the next few years. Advantages of outsourcing software development cost factors. Developers who are expert in a niche ask for a lot of money. Whilst there are some risks to outsourcing, they are typically outweighed by the pros. With processes that integrate right into your operational procedures, outsourcing software development projects just seem like an extended arm of your inhouse team. By going nearshore, you can also save on office space and employee benefits. Efforts that are spent by people on the needs of the project.
Now that you know all the advantages and disadvantages of outsourcing software development, lets see what responsibilities you can pass on to your software outsourcing partner. We will look at average hourly rates for it outsourcing in asia, africa, australia, europe as well as in north and south america. Apr 18, 2017 actually, based on publicly available info, we know the core development was outsourced in russia, starting with a contractor iphone developer named igor solomennikov who joined the company eventually as cio. Software outsourcing india offshore it software development. Actually, based on publicly available info, we know the core development was outsourced in russia, starting with a contractor iphone developer named igor solomennikov who joined the company eventually as cio. Outsourcing software development means a reduction in cost and capital expenditure for the company. The cost of the application is paid according to the time spent developing it. Do you plan to outsource a development project web, mobile or software and want to know how much does it cost to outsource software development.
How does outsourcing help reduce software development costs. How much should you pay to achieve satisfying quality with offshore software development outsourcing. Many companies will choose outsourcing as a way of saving even though saving money is not the only reason for outsourcing, as you can read in our previous blog post about pros and cons for outsourced vs. For instance, outsourcing rates in ukraine are lower than those in poland.
In order to address any technical issues, you will be at the mercy of a vendor who sets and can change the price of. Advantages and disadvantages of outsourcing software. For the majority, the biggest decisive factor for outsourcing software development is cost. There are obvious advantages to outsourcing software development, such as cost saving, access to a skilled team, etc. Jun 26, 2019 any costs related to data conversion, user training, administration, and overhead should be charged to expense as incurred. In the past, organizations chose to outsource software development mainly because of the significant cost reduction. The worlds biggest tech hubs to hire experienced software developers are asia, eastern europe, africa. Lets take a look at both the advantages and disadvantages of outsourcing software development, and why we believe our services at accelerance are the best in the business. Now lets gauge the amount needed to outsource to eastern european professionals. And that is great news, as one has plenty to learn from before deciding to pay someone to build an app. In this article, youll learn more about ukraine as the software development outsourcing destination, get the idea about outsourcing rates and find the. With outsourcing, you can cut up to 60% of operational costs. Commercial software can accrue high support and maintenance costs. Jan 24, 2020 clearly, outsourcing mobile app development gives you access to the best professionals worldwide.
Why outsourcing software development is a good option for. Dec 04, 2018 outsourcing software development has emerged as a global trend in todays digital world. Check out the companys experience find out if the software development vendor has the developers who are qualified in your domain. Heres is what you should know about software development outsourcing companies. Finally, theres offshore outsourcing and thats where the real cost savings are rooted in. Aug 14, 2014 of course the internet has changed all this and global outsourcing of software development was truly a disruptive technology that costs so much less that people are willing to put up with. And the motivations for outsourcing are evolving as well. The true costs and potential risks of outsourcing software. Business outsourcing software development and the hidden costs that surprise companies. Outsource software development services software outsourcing. Outsourcing has sparked serious and growing debate. Lets take a closer look at the benefits of outsourcing compared to inhouse software development.
Top saas companies that outsourced software development. Outsourcing software development in high living cost countries may ensure quality. The overall cost of development is defined by the project requirements, platform, the technology used, developers experience, and location. Just to paraphrase to outsource, or not to outsource. Outsourcing software development and the hidden costs that. Capitalization of software development costs accountingtools. The 3 stages of capitalizing internally developed software. Software development outsourcing vs inhouse hiring blog. Those responsible for accounting and reporting the costs of externaluse software development should discuss these issues with the project management team before the launch of any major development project, as the capitalization of software development costs is required when thresholds under gaap are met. In a battle of inhouse vs outsourcing software development, the engineering services costs make a. Despite the risks, software outsourcing is a viable option and can result in cost savings. Accounting for externaluse software development costs in.
Of course the internet has changed all this and global outsourcing of software development was truly a disruptive technology. The price of outsourcing app development in the united states will vary especially based on location. How much it cost to outsource mobile app development. Oct 09, 2017 were bringing you here a shortlist of both the main pros and cons of inhouse vs. Outsourcing, not only of servicerelated but now also of business critical tasks like software development has been increasing ever since information and communication technologies have become much more advanced. Why companies outsource software development to other countries. If you are into the construction of any new project website, or a manager of your team, or an entrepreneur running in the race of starting up your own business.
We use a hypothetical software development project to explore the costs and risks for both onshore and offshore outsourcing. Outsourced embedded software and hardware development. These 2 concepts are highly interesting if you plan to launch a new software solution soon. V cost of hiring software developers with niche skills. Many entities develop software that will either be used internally or sold to others. Software product development outsourcing sciencesoft.
It gives you a chance to test the modules, features, and following the beta stage of development. India is an oldest and the most popular place for it outsourcing. The primary subtopics in the financial accounting standards boards accounting standards codification asc that must be considered when determining the accounting treatment for the related software development costs are asc 98520, software costs of software to be sold, leased, or marketed. Cost of outsourcing mobile app development is similar to asking how much a car cost. Its a popular way for businesses to lower operational costs and streamline operations while.
Healthcare software development company nisos health. And even though outsourcing has its benefits, it also has its faults. The truth about outsourcing software development costs. Lower costs outsourcing software development can cut down the overall cost of a project because you dont have to spend a lot of money to train your inhouse team.
Global it services market software development cost ssa group. Software development outsourcing a free guide from diceus. Accounting for externaluse software development costs in an. What, why, where and how software outsourcing can reduce software development cost while still allowing your company focuses on its core competencies. Top offshore software development company in vietnam. Outsourcing of software development is india still the best. If a company opts for hiring an outsourced software development team for handling the same tasks as an inhouse team would, isnt it somewhat foolish to suddenly start prioritizing cost over quality. If you hire a middlesenior dedicated developer, the.
This document is revised with latest facts and figures that favor india as the frontrunner in offshore outsourcing for software development. Outsourcing helps thousands of software development companies create. If youre reading this article, youre probably in search of a way to build a software product. The exact cost of outsourcing mobile app development in 2019. Offshore developer rates guide to know outsourcing rates. Jun 12, 2019 having decided to build software or application there is a need to determine how to organize the development process. Outsourcing rates for software development in ukraine medium. Factors that affect the price and outsourcing software development costs are provided in our article. Gone are the days when outsourcing was considered purely for budgetary reasons. The primary subtopics in the financial accounting standards boards accounting standards codification asc that must be considered when determining the accounting treatment for the related software development costs are asc 98520, software costs of software to be sold, leased, or marketed, and asc 350.
Average hourly rates of outsourced software engineers. Software development outsourcing has many benefits. Inhouse vs outsourced software development rubygarage blog. Lets discuss the major factors why companies outsource their software development to other countries. Were going to focus on the three most common reasons why companies choose outsourcing over traditional inhouse teams.
How much should you pay for software outsourcing to get the very. The true costs and potential risks of outsourcing software development. Health it integrationsinterface development api, hl7, fhir, ccda. How much does it cost to outsource software development. Since 1997, we have been bringing digital transformation to midsized and large enterprises in banking and finance, insurance, telecommunications, healthcare and retail. Outsourcing software development is here to stay as an it trend which has evolved, grown, matured and is living up to and outgrowing its potential. Driven by its costeffective benefits, many founders are riding the outsourcing wave. There are six countries in the african continent where you can outsource software development morocco, egypt, nigeria, kenya, tunisia, and south africa.
Mar 20, 2019 how much does it cost to develop software. Consultant for outsourcing of software development. What it really costs to outsource software development. Many large, global businesses started out in a garage outsourcing their embryonic ideas to build up. The primary reason why companies choose to outsource software development is to save costs. The accounting standards split the development process of internaluse software into three different stages. Mar 19, 2019 now that you know all the advantages and disadvantages of outsourcing software development, lets see what responsibilities you can pass on to your software outsourcing partner. Were bringing you here a shortlist of both the main pros and cons of inhouse vs. It is typical of outsourced software developers to supervise all the customary software development tasks. Best countries to outsource software development full scale.
How much should you pay for an outsourced developer. Four best countries to outsource software development. Namely, the local cost of development services, lack of talents, high taxes, strict timeframes, etc. Cost is usually the first reason most companies consider outsourcing software development. Elinext is an app, software development and consulting company focusing on web, mobile, desktop and embedded software solutions, qa and testing. While on one hand, outsourcing software development can allow firms to save money on the cost of creating software and give them access to technological capabilities they dont have inhouse. Offshore product development, offshore web and app development. The truth about outsourcing software development costs manifera. Why outsourcing development is beneficial to any type of business.
Why isnt all software development outsourced to countries. Hiring the same dedicated software developer through an. Average hourly rates for offshore software development cost. Today we going to tell about a budget for outsourcing when hiring a dedicated team of developers for your projects in different countries around the world. Nov 30, 2017 according to table 2, inhouse development in the usa with all the notsoobvious expenses factored in will cost you quite a fortune. Did you know there are approximately 300,000 jobs outsourced by the united states each year every company has its own reason for doing this, with many chasing lower labor costs. The security costs of outsourcing software development. As a healthcare software development company, our outsourced software development department works with healthcare payers, providers and independent software vendors to help them. Many underestimate what it means switching to offshore development. Stop outsourcing your software development it outsourcing head points to risks and hidden expenses of outsourcing. Whether youre a startup or an experienced company, you want to build your product fast, keep the quality high, and keep the costs low. Top software development outsourcing companies of 2020. We use mature management processes and effective software development methodologies cicd, devops, optimally utilize resources and offer reasonable rates without compromising software and process quality to make sure we achieve your software development goals without excessive costs.
Average hourly rates for offshore software development. Building a saas product introduces a lot of challenges especially acquiring the right talent for the project, meeting budget and time targets. Offshore developer rates guide to know outsourcing rates by. Sensinum advises on how to decrease software development costs still retain quality. Grounded firmly on the foundations of trust, teamwork and technology, itoi has been providing offshore software development services for companies across the globe from the software outsourcing center in india. Of course the internet has changed all this and global outsourcing of software development was truly a disruptive technology that costs so. Companies have lots of reasons to outsource the development to software companies in europe. You gain access to talented worldclass developers, save money and dont have to hire an. The cost of hiring software developers in your own country can vary and may sway the decision to outsource to foreign companies.
Offshore development rates in eastern europe vary from country to country. Why outsource, how to outsource development, and how much does it cost to make an app on outsource is our subject of scrutiny this time. Canada, india, ireland, and israel were the four leading countries as of 2003. Read the guide to detect the most suitable price and location for your offshore development team. Since 1997, we have been bringing digital transformation to midsized and large enterprises in banking and finance. In a battle of inhouse vs outsourcing software development, the engineering services costs. Among others, one can name the pool of experts, flexibility, timesaving, accessibility alongside the fact that managing outsourced software development is simplified by cloud technology and project management tools. You dont need to commit yourself to creating a large and costly team if you are not. Software development costs and factors affecting its price. Whats more, you can reduce software development costs by 2030% and conduct frequent facetoface meetings with your remote employees. You get to pay just for the time developers work while when you hire developers yourself your software development costs remain high regardless of the volume of work. The accounting guidance specifies 3 stages of internaluse software development and during which stages capitalization is required.
Applied software engineering limited ase, one of the uks leading outsourced embedded software and hardware development companies, provides outsourced development for both bespoke and customized embedded software and hardware to a wide range of industries. How to outsource appsoftware development and how much it. How much should you pay in order to achieve comparable quality with offshore software development outsourcing. Software asaservice saas we take over your saas software development and implement either a singletenant granting maximum privacy and security or multitenant offering reduced costs and easy version control architecture. How tech companies deal with software development costs. Outsourcing as a business instrument comes in handy on various occasions.